10 Reasons Why You Should Invest in Bitcoin
High potential for returns
Bitcoin has been one of the best-performing assets of the past decade, with significant price gains since its inception. While there is no guarantee that past performance will continue in the future, the potential for high returns is one reason to consider investing in Bitcoin.
Limited supply
There will never be more than 21 million bitcoins in circulation, making it a scarce asset. This limited supply can drive up the price of Bitcoin as demand increases.
Decentralization
Bitcoin is decentralized, meaning it is not controlled by any government or financial institution. This can provide a level of security and independence that other investment options may not have.
Global acceptance
Bitcoin is accepted as a payment method by an increasing number of merchants and businesses worldwide. This could increase the demand for Bitcoin in the future.
Diversification
Bitcoin can be a useful addition to a diversified investment portfolio. By including Bitcoin, investors can spread their risk across different asset classes.
Increasing institutional adoption
More and more institutional investors, such as hedge funds and mutual funds, are investing in Bitcoin. This can provide legitimacy to the asset and potentially increase its value.
Increasing mainstream adoption
As more people become familiar with Bitcoin and cryptocurrency, its adoption may continue to increase. This could lead to a higher demand for Bitcoin, driving up its price.
Lower fees
Transactions with Bitcoin can have lower fees compared to traditional payment methods, which can be attractive to some investors.
Hedge against inflation
Bitcoin is often viewed as a potential hedge against inflation, as its supply is limited and not subject to the same inflationary pressures as traditional currencies.
Technological innovation
Bitcoin is built on blockchain technology, which has the potential to disrupt various industries beyond just finance. Investing in Bitcoin can provide exposure to this technological innovation.
